Rental Market Trends

Hesperia, CA

As of March 2025, Hesperia's rental market is compet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units. Hesperia's average rent is 34.8% ($863) lower than the California average of $2,482 and 9.5% ($169) lower than the U.S. average of $1,788.

Frequently Asked Questions
Hesperia Rental Market FAQs

Explore rental prices, market trends, and availability in Hesperia, CA.

The average rent in Hesperia, CA is $1,619 per month.
Homes in Hesperia typically rent for between $949 and $2,932 per month, with an average of $1,619 per month.
In Hesperia, the average rent for a 1-bedroom home is $1,356 per month, for a 2-bedroom home, $1,672 per month, and a 3-bedroom home is $2,255 per month.
The average rent in Hesperia is 9.5% ($169) lower than the national average of $1,788 per month.
The average rent in Hesperia has increased by 2.6% ($41) in the last month and decreased by 23.2% ($490) over the past year.
The rental market in Hesperia, CA, is currently compet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units.
In Hesperia, CA, the average rental stays on the market for approximately 37 days. While most properties are rented within this timeframe, factors like seasonality, demand, and property type can affect how quickly a rental leases.
There are currently 41 rental properties available in Hesperia, CA.
Based on the current averages, a household would need an annual income of $66,880 to comfortably afford a 2-bedroom home in Hesperia.
